Girl Gives the Last of Her Money to Pay a Stranger’s Fine on the Bus, Cries When She Sees Him at Her Prom

Carly, a sixteen-year-old girl, lived with her mother, Dina, and grandmother, Holly. Though they struggled financially, they saved enough to buy Carly a prom dress. Overwhelmed with gratitude, Carly thanked them and set off to buy the dress.

On the bus, Carly noticed a distressed man who couldn’t pay his fare. He explained that he was rushing to his sick daughter but had forgotten his wallet. Carly, moved by his desperation, gave him the money intended for her dress to pay his fine. The man, Rick, was deeply thankful.

When Carly returned home without a dress, her mother was upset, but her grandmother comforted her, saying, “Helping someone in need is never wrong.” Carly, unsure of her decision, felt conflicted.

On prom night, Carly wore an old dress and felt out of place. However, Rick appeared with his healthy daughter, Haley, and presented Carly with a beautiful dress as thanks. Overwhelmed, Carly entered her prom feeling like the princess she had dreamed of being.

Her act of kindness had come full circle, proving that generosity often brings unexpected rewards.
